Output 75a8b54b543e142cad5b18f29ca18dc7c3422496ec8693e2acdc97151040798b:0

value
308976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53dd5a13737ad8b428714ea5609b46dbea7d8a2f OP_EQUAL
address
39LTBGBGN7rioHjPDfwka32oSKqXBJNHU2
transaction
75a8b54b543e142cad5b18f29ca18dc7c3422496ec8693e2acdc97151040798b
confirmations
225409
spent
true